Mezopotamya News Agency (MA) reporter Zeynep Durgut was taken into custody in a house raid in Cizre district in Turkey’s southeastern province of Şırnak (Şırnex) on February 14, 2022.
Durgut was detained in a house raid, handcuffed behind her back, and taken to the Şırnak Security Directorate. Durgut’s statement was taken at the security directorate after two days in custody yesterday (February 16). Durgut’s journalist activities were treated as evidence, and she was also asked questions about the news she had shared on her social media accounts during the interrogation.
The journalists – Durgut and her four colleagues had been charged with reporting on Osman Şiban and Servet Turgut, two Kurdish villagers who had been thrown from a helicopter in Van’s Çatak district. Journalist Durgut and her four colleagues were charged with “membership of organization” over their news, but they were acquitted a year later, on January 6, 2022.
A social media campaign was also started for journalist Zeynep Durgut, who was detained in Cizre district, with the hashtag #Zeynep Durgut’a Özgürlük (Freedom for Zeynep Durgut). Several journalists, politicians, institutions and non-governmental organizations supported the campaign.

Dicle Fırat Journalists Association (DFG) stated the following on its official Twitter account :
“She has been detained many times before. Each time she was subjected to different interrogation process. However, Zeynep’s only fault was being a journalist. ”

Media and Law Studies Association (MLSA) also joined to the campaign stating:
” Zeynep Durgut and four colleagues were put on trial for reporting the violations of rights and doing their profession charged with “terrorism” and acquitted on January 6. Durgut was detained again with reverse handcuffs 41 days later.”
